1. Biography of Charlotte York

Charlotte York, portrayed by Kristin Davis, is one of the four main characters in HBO's acclaimed series Sex and the City, which aired from 1998 to 2004. Born into a wealthy family, Charlotte represents traditional values and has a strong desire for a fairy-tale romance. Her character is known for her optimistic outlook on love, despite facing numerous challenges throughout the series.

2. Character Development Throughout the Series

Charlotte's character development is one of the most compelling arcs in Sex and the City. Starting as a hopeless romantic, she often finds herself navigating the ups and downs of love. Her journey is marked by significant growth as she learns to balance her ideals with reality.

Early Seasons: The Fairy-Tale Dreamer

In the early seasons, Charlotte is depicted as the quintessential romantic who believes in fairy-tale endings. Her desire for a perfect relationship leads her to make decisions that often backfire, such as her tumultuous marriage to Trey MacDougal.

Later Seasons: Embracing Reality

As the series progresses, Charlotte's character evolves. She learns to embrace the imperfections of love and relationships. Her eventual marriage to Harry Goldenblatt signifies her growth and acceptance of herself and her desires.

3. Key Relationships

Charlotte's relationships are central to her character and the narrative of Sex and the City. Her journey through love showcases the complexities of modern romance.

Trey MacDougal: The Fairy-Tale Gone Wrong

Charlotte's marriage to Trey MacDougal is a pivotal point in her story. Initially, he seems to embody her fairy-tale dreams, but their relationship becomes strained due to Trey's immaturity and Charlotte's expectations. This relationship ultimately ends in divorce, teaching Charlotte valuable lessons about love and compatibility.

Harry Goldenblatt: The Unexpected Love

Harry Goldenblatt, Charlotte's second husband, represents the love she never expected. Their relationship is built on mutual respect and understanding, highlighting the importance of accepting one's partner as they are. Harry's down-to-earth personality complements Charlotte's traditional values, creating a balanced partnership.

5. Charlotte's Iconic Fashion

Charlotte York is known for her impeccable fashion sense, which reflects her personality. Her style is characterized by femininity, elegance, and a touch of whimsy.

  • Classic Looks: Charlotte often wears tailored dresses that emphasize her figure and convey a sense of sophistication.
  • Playful Accessories: She frequently incorporates fun accessories, such as hats and statement jewelry, to add a personal touch to her outfits.
  • Color Palette: Charlotte's wardrobe is often adorned with soft pastels and vibrant colors, representing her optimistic outlook.
